We are hunting a self-sufficient sales professional who is motivated by driving new business, works well under pressure, and accountable to ensure goals are consistently achieved by driving top line revenue. Job Description: Customer-Focused Results-Driven An Effective Communicator Trustworthy and Honest Organizationally Savvy Responsibilities: Establish contact with potential qualified buyers of inspection services by diligently scheduling sales calls, following up on leads quickly after they're identified, and helping to execute outlined marketing strategies. Determine customer needs by conducting site surveys and reviewing your findings with the appropriate customer personnel. Prepare and present effective proposals that offer solutions to customer life safety needs. Contribute to the pricing approach of inspection accounts. Maintain and report Western States Fire Protection sales business plan and attend monthly sales call. Holds responsibility for understanding of assigned market and reporting business dynamics (market share, competition, top customers, top prospects, etc.) of assigned geographic area. Develop and maintain an active proposal pipeline to support the established sales business plan. Develop caring and enduring customer relationships that meet and exceed the expectations of our customers. Support other Western States Fire Protection and APi Group teams in their initiatives as they relate to your territory. Learn and follow the Western States Fire Protection Operating code 100% of the time. Requirements: 5+ years Sales experience a must Sales experience related to the fire and life safety industry and/or building services and maintenance is a plus. Strong oral and written communications are a must. Willing to present information and respond to questions from managers, customers, AHJs (Authorities Having Jurisdiction), and the general public. Business development and/or marketing experience is a plus. Proficient in use of Microsoft Office Suite (Excel, Word, Outlook). Possess a valid driver's license, in accordance with Company policy.
